Where to Use Caution

While the Red Poppy Flower Design has strong potential, there are specific constraints every embroiderer must respect. Ignoring these can lead to production failures and dissatisfied customers.

  1. Small Patch Sizes: If you intend to make very small patches (under 2 inches), you must inspect the stitch density. Fine details in the center of the flower may merge together if the scale is too small. Always test at the actual production size.
  2. Curved Surfaces: While caps are good candidates, highly curved items like beanies or fitted sleeves can distort the symmetry of a single flower. Ensure your digitizing software accounts for the curvature of the garment during the stitching process.
  3. Dark Uniforms and Fabric Texture: Red pops against light backgrounds, but on dark fabrics, you need sufficient thread coverage. If the fabric has a heavy texture, such as thick wool or rough burlap, fine outlines may get lost. Consider using a denser fill stitch for the petals to ensure opacity.
  4. Frequent Washing: For items like work shirts or cafe aprons that undergo industrial laundering, the stability of the design is key. Loose threads or insufficient backing can cause the design to pucker or unravel over time.

File Format Compatibility

The product description lists extensive compatibility, including formats such as PES, DST, JEF, EXP, HUS, VP3, VIP, PEC, XXX, TAP, PCS, CND, DSB, DSZ, ART, and 10O. This wide range ensures that regardless of your machine brand—whether it is Brother, Janome, Tajima, or Barudan—you can utilize this digital embroidery file without conversion issues. Always double-check the specific requirements of your machine’s software to ensure seamless integration.
